E-portfolios allow students
an opportunity to store work they feel
demonstrates their proficiency in the four
Thomas College Core Competencies of
Communication, Leadership and Service,
Analytical Reasoning and Community &
Interpersonal Relations.
Materials can come from class
projects, extra-curricular and work experiences.
Because it's an electronic format a variety of
file types can be stored in the portfolios.
From documents and spreadsheets to music and
photographs - the portfolio accommodates them
all.
The portfolios are set up on
the SharePoint Portal Server on the Thomas
College system. If they choose, students
may also decide to create a web-page styled
version of their electronic portfolio.
